Summary
Maverick is seeking an Accountant to oversee various aspects of finance, including recording transactions, managing accounts payable and accounts receivable, processing payroll, preparing financial statements, and ensuring compliance with accounting standards and regulations. The accounts payable function will involve processing vendor invoices, verifying accuracy, obtaining approvals, vendor statements, and ensuring timely payments. The accounts receivable function will generate customer invoices, monitor collections, apply payments, and reconcile accounts. Moreover, the Accountant plays a key role in managing payroll, calculating and processing employee salaries, deductions, and benefits in compliance with applicable regulations as well as compiling data from various sources to create accurate and compliant financial statements.
Responsibilities
- Financial Recordkeeping: Maintain complete and accurate financial records, including general ledger, acc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ll, and bank reconciliations.
- Bookkeeping Entries: Record financial transactions by entering data into the accounting system, including sales, purchases, receipts, and payments. Ensure proper classification and accurate allocation of expenses and revenues.
- Accounts Payable: Process vendor invoices, verify accuracy, obtain necessary approvals, and prepare payments. Maintain vendor records, reconcile statements, and resolve discrepancies.
- Accounts Receivable: Generate customer invoices, monitor collections, and track accounts receivable balances. Apply payments, reconcile accounts, and pursue collections when necessary.
- Payroll Management: Calculate and process employee payroll, including tax withholdings, deductions, and benefits. Ensure compliance with payroll regulations and maintain accurate payroll records.
- Financial Reporting: Help prepare financial statements, including income statements, balance sheets, and cash flow statements, on a regular basis. Analyze financial data and provide management with accurate and timely reports.
- Compliance and Regulations: Ensure compliance with relevant accounting principles, industry regulations, and tax requirements. Stay updated with changes in accounting standards and maintain proper documentation for audits.
- Reconciliation and Analysis: Perform bank reconciliations, credit card reconciliations, and other account reconciliations. Analyze financial data, identify trends, and provide insights to support business decisions.
- Financial Systems Management: Maintain and optimize the accounting software system. Identify opportunities for process improvement and implement best practices for efficiency.
- Problem Solving: Identify and resolve accounting and financial discrepancies. Investigate and address issues related to financial records, transactions, and reporting.

About Us
Maverick Corporation is a full-service Engineering and Construction firm working in the telecommunications, Electrical vehicle infrastructure and electrical power sectors. Our customers range from traditional municipal and co-op electric utilities and telecommunication service providers to companies operating in the oil & gas and the transportation industries. Maverick Corporation and its affiliates provide project management, quality control and review services; aerial, underground, and technical services in construction; as well as design, survey, permitting, and owner’s agent services in engineering. Maverick has been incorporated since 1994, and is a growing company with headquarters in Boston, Massachusetts.
